What Is the Range of Current MG Electric Cars in Brisbane?

This year, MG offers three EV models as part of the standard lineup: the MG4, MG ZS EV, and MG HS EV are all shining examples of ingenuity and performance. Drivers can expect optimal power, energy efficiency, and sophistication from each of these MG models.

MG4

The MG4 is one of the most exciting EVs on the market. Every element of this car is designed for breathtaking performance, from the standard rear-wheel-drive drivetrain to the exceptional 350 km electric driving range. This car has an acceleration speed of zero to 100 km/h in 7.7 seconds. The four trim levels for this vehicle are Excite 51, Excite 64, Essence 64, and Long Range 77.

The Excite 51 trim has many standard features, including a reverse camera, electronic parking brake, and 17-inch alloy wheels. Thoughtful details like the seven-inch digital cluster, 10.25-inch infotainment touchscreen, and 60/40 split folding rear seats increase the convenience of this vehicle. This MG comes with the MG Pilot safety suite and wireless connectivity to your favourite audio apps like Apple CarPlay and Android Auto.

ZS EV

This mid-size fully-electric SUV is the epitome of style and function. The ZS EV has a lithium-ion battery that produces 130 kW of power with 280 Nm of torque. The electric driving range is 320 km and the combined driving efficiency is 17.7 kWh/100 km. The trim levels for this EV are Excite, Essence, and Long Range.

For the base trim, key features include a leather-trimmed steering wheel, push-button start, LED daytime running lights, and a six-way manually adjustable driver's seat. The 360-degree view camera pairs nicely with the MG Pilot safety suite. Drivers can maximise the efficiency of this vehicle with three customisable driving modes and three regenerative braking modes.

HS EV

The HS EV has a pure electric motor that is paired with a turbocharged petrol engine for a super powerful hybrid powertrain. This SUV has a combined fuel consumption of 1.7L/100 km, generates 189 kW and 370 Nm of torque, and has a battery capacity of 16.6 kWh. The full electric driving range is an estimated 63 km.

This model comes in two trims: Excite and Essence. The Excite trim offers standard features such as a 10.1-inch touchscreen, a 12.3-inch virtual cockpit, built-in satellite navigation, and connectivity with Android Auto and Apple CarPlay. The 17-inch alloy rims, halogen headlights, keyless entry, rain-sensing wipers, heated front seats, and MG Pilot safety suite are also standard.
